ZIP 13835 vs ZIP 13841
A side-by-side comparison of ZIP Code 13835 and ZIP Code 13841: population, income, housing, and more.
ZIP 13835 and ZIP 13841 are ZIP Code areas in New York.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
ZIP 13835 has the higher population (1,182 vs 394 in ZIP 13841). ZIP 13835 has the higher median household income ($71,688 vs $53,125 in ZIP 13841). ZIP 13841 has the higher median home value ($115,000 vs $105,000 in ZIP 13835).
Population, income & housing
| ZIP 13835 | ZIP 13841 |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 1,182 | 394 |
| Median age | 54.3 yrs | 41.6 yrs |
| Median household income | $71,688 | $53,125 |
| Median home value | $105,000 | $115,000 |
| Median gross rent | $732 | $1,125 |
| Housing units | 612 | 274 |
| Homeownership rate | 82.4% | 75.5%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 25.4% | 20.2% |
| Unemployment rate | 7.2% | 4.8% |
